Mets Roll Past Giants Despite Juan Soto Absence

New York's deep lineup powers team to victory without star outfielder.

Apr. 5, 2026 at 9:25am by Ben Kaplan

The New York Mets defeated the San Francisco Giants on Tuesday, shaking off the absence of star outfielder Juan Soto who suffered a minor calf strain. Despite Soto's injury, the Mets' deep and talented lineup was able to power the team to victory, showcasing the team's offensive depth and consistency.
